迁移博客,obsidian及图片路径相关问题

lena dahuaidan
1
2
3
4
5

发现报错:

```text
ERROR Deployer not found: git

只需要安装:

1
npm install hexo-deployer-git --save

另外俩报错

ssh连接方式及Connection closed by 198.xx.xx.xx port 22错误解决
https://blog.csdn.net/m0_60340438/article/details/141273109
Nunjucks Error: 解决方案
https://blog.csdn.net/weixin_45333934/article/details/108274320

需求:

  1. 图片显示
    • 比较简单的解决方案是使用相对路径
    • 图片必须在source/images下才能显示,否则不管什么相对路径都不管用(是不是主题的问题?烦死啦哈哈)
  2. 所有的笔记都在学习仓库里,不可能单独在博客仓库下编辑,所以需要从学习仓库里把笔记和图片都传到博客仓库
    • 解决方案:使用obsidian插件envelope,将学习仓库中的笔记上传再pull,然后再执行hexo d -g(后续要考虑自动化)
    • 问题:该插件所有的文章都被传到同一个文件夹,即不能图片单独传到source/images下,就算pull后手动将图片移到images下,文章的图片路径(学习仓库里的相对路径)没法改成博客仓库的相对路径。。。


  • 标题: 迁移博客,obsidian及图片路径相关问题
  • 作者: lena
  • 创建于: 2025-03-08 14:56:09
  • 更新于: 2025-03-08 19:35:41
  • 链接: https://lenaaa0.github.io/2025/03/3ab441bd3ff9.html
  • 版权声明: 本文章采用 CC BY-NC-SA 4.0 进行许可。
 评论
此页目录
迁移博客,obsidian及图片路径相关问题